Berthing Outfit and Connections
The ship provides the permanent compartment, structure, fire boundary, escape path, ventilation trunk, and qualified electrical and data junctions. ATLAS supplies replaceable bunks, semi-enclosed petty-officer berths, lockers, privacy panels, lighting and data devices, furnishings, and standardized attachment hardware.
Fixed-Space Boundary
ATLAS standardizes the outfitting inside fixed berthing compartments. It does not turn the galley, mess decks, wardroom, laundry, command centers, engineering rooms, or damage-control lockers into removable room containers.
What It Is
- Acronym meaning: ATLAS = Adaptable Transformable Living Architecture System.
- Purpose: standardize berthing furniture, partitions, stowage, lighting, data, attachment points, and maintenance clearances across all three classes.
- Structural rule: decks, bulkheads, fire and watertight boundaries, passageways, escape routes, ventilation trunks, drains, and utility runs are designed into the hull and do not move.
- Enlisted berthing standard: ATLAS uses a configurable E1-E6 outfit inside a fixed compartment rather than a fixed-capacity room designation.
- Baseline configuration: six E1-E4 sailors use two three-high bunk stacks, while two E5-E6 petty officers receive individual semi-enclosed single berths.
- Alternate configurations: a junior-heavy department may use nine E1-E4 berths plus one E5-E6 berth; a petty-officer-heavy team may use three E1-E4 berths plus three E5-E6 berths.
- Rank boundary: E4 is PO3 in Navy rating structure but remains in the junior triple-stack allocation for this space-planning standard. CPO and officer berthing are defined separately.
- Neighborhood rule: quiet berthing compartments, fixed heads/showers, a small lounge or ready room, and appropriate fitness space are arranged by the naval architect. Common outfitting does not dictate an inefficient container grid.
- Operational effect: cross-deck crew familiarity and reduced platform-unique accommodation rework during refit and block upgrades.
- Industrial effect: module campuses can produce accepted bunks, lockers, partitions, furnishings, sanitary fixtures, and installation kits without building complete removable rooms.
Fixed-Space Boundary
- Central ship services: laundry, barber shop, and ship's store are purpose-built in a central service zone. Retail Services Specialists operate these functions; Logistics Specialists support supply and inventory functions.
- Food and hospitality: galley, scullery, mess decks, CPO mess, wardroom, and flag/VIP dining are purpose-built spaces operated through the Culinary Specialist organization.
- Training and administration: classrooms, conference rooms, briefing rooms, and offices are fixed spaces; movable partitions and common furniture may provide flexibility.
- Damage control: repair lockers and emergency equipment stations are fixed and distributed by fire zone, casualty access, and survivability requirements, with Damage Controlmen providing the specialist backbone.
- Command and machinery: Bridge, CIC, DMC, ATC, sonar control, radio, communications, electrical rooms, machinery rooms, and engineering control spaces are fixed parts of the class design.

Next Flight Implementation Steps
- Standardize berthing outfit interfaces, fasteners, clearances, materials, fire performance, shock requirements, and human factors.
- Qualify representative fixed-compartment mockups for egress, noise, sanitation, maintainability, and casualty response.
- Roll out common outfit packages through module-campus production and install them during construction or scheduled refit.
Options and Styles
- Enlisted Outfit Options: standard 6+2, junior-heavy 9+1, and petty-officer-heavy 3+3 configurations use the same fixed-compartment interface.
- Other Berthing: CPO, officer, flag, and VIP accommodations are separate outfit standards developed later against their own privacy, office, and command-support requirements.
- Layout Styles: room size and adjacency remain class-specific naval-architecture decisions; the fittings and installation interfaces remain common.
- Delivery Style: module campuses deliver serialized outfit kits and replaceable equipment rather than complete room containers.
Mounting and Integration Particulars
- Installed into purpose-built compartments using common attachment, electrical, data, lighting, and ventilation-interface standards.
- Refits replace worn or obsolete fittings without cutting out a room, disturbing primary structure, or rerouting major ship services.
CPO and Officer Berthing Layouts
Senior berthing remains purpose-built into the hull and uses common ATLAS furnishings, attachment points, lockers, lighting, data, and service interfaces. Room dimensions and final quantities scale by class, but the occupancy rules remain common.
CPO (E7-E9) Shared Berthing and Command Master Chief Cabin
Planning layout: four to six CPOs share a fixed compartment with individual single-level berths, privacy curtains or panels, lockers, and a common dressing aisle. The Command Master Chief receives a private cabin near command spaces and CPO country. Other E9 personnel remain in shared CPO berthing unless a specific billet requires separate quarters.
- Shared baseline: E7-E9 normally berth four to six per compartment; the drawing shows the six-person arrangement.
- Privacy standard: no junior-enlisted triple stacks; each CPO receives a single-level berth, personal locker, reading light, charging/data point, and privacy enclosure.
- Private exception: the ship's Command Master Chief receives a private cabin with a single berth, desk, locker, and secure communications/data point.
- Separate fixed spaces: CPO mess, lounge, heads, showers, and offices remain purpose-built shared spaces adjacent to, but not inside, the sleeping compartment.
Officer Shared Staterooms and Private Command Cabins
Planning layout: officers normally share two-person staterooms with individual single-level berths, desks, and lockers. The Commanding Officer, Executive Officer, and Chief Medical Officer receive private cabins. On the CAG, the Lead Flight Officer and senior USMC QRF officer also receive private cabins. CAG flag quarters and VIP suites remain separate command accommodations, not part of routine officer berthing.
- Shared baseline: officers below the private-cabin exceptions normally share two-person staterooms, including department heads unless class manning and available volume justify a different assignment.
- Fleetwide private exceptions: the CO, XO, and Chief Medical Officer each receive a private cabin with berth, desk, locker, and secure communications/data point.
- CAG operational exceptions: the Lead Flight Officer and senior USMC QRF officer each receive a private cabin appropriate to their embarked-force leadership and around-the-clock operational responsibilities.
- CAG command exception: the embarked flag officer receives separate flag quarters with staff, briefing, and command-support spaces. VIP accommodations remain separate from the ship's routine officer berthing allocation.
- Separate fixed spaces: wardroom, officer lounge, heads, showers, offices, and briefing rooms remain fixed common spaces designed into each class.
